My problem (I think it's a worldwide problem) is with table and figure cross-references when inserted in a sentence,
the minimum option available for tables and figures is "Only label and number" for example, "as shown in Table 3.1", see attached image.
I googled for a time on how to insert the only numbers for cross-references of tables and figures, but without benefits, and this is impossible. So we will work with "Only label and number" as minimum option.

So my need is a VBA code to put the number of cross-references inside the parenthesis () and convert the label (Table, Figure) to lowercase because it is not suitable when not come at the start of a sentence.

I can do my need manually, but firstly, it takes a lot of time, secondly, suppose if I delete a certain table or figure, then updating cross-references, it will restore the original format, so the VBA code will solve this issue.

From the attached files, you can download exercise files to apply on it ("For scientific paper" just contain cross-reference number, ex: as shown in Table 3, while "For thesis" the cross-references number contain chapter number additionally, ex: as shown in Table 1.3).
